Comprehensive Guide to US 1040 2010

Understanding the 2010 US Federal Individual Income Tax Return

The 2010 US Federal Individual Income Tax Return, known as Form 1040, serves as the primary document for individuals to report their annual income to the IRS. This form is essential for taxpayers as it outlines their financial obligations and ensures compliance with federal tax laws. To validate the submission, signatures from both the taxpayer and the preparer are required.

To file the 2010 US Federal Individual Income Tax Return, you must have had income during that tax year and provide valid personal identification details such as Social Security Numbers.
The deadline for filing the 2010 tax return is typically April 15, 2011. If you missed this deadline, consider filing for an extension, though penalties may apply.
You can submit your completed 2010 tax return electronically via e-filing services or by mailing the physical form to the IRS using the address specified for your region.
You will typically need W-2 forms, 1099 forms for other income, receipts for deductions, and any other documentation supporting your financial claims on the return.
Avoid common mistakes such as forgetting to sign and date your form, entering incorrect Social Security Numbers, and failing to account for all income sources.
Processing times can vary, but electronic filings are usually processed within 21 days. Paper returns may take longer and often exceed several weeks.
